Department of Climate Change, Energy, the Environment and Water of Australia Government 2700 $267M Australia Converlens Converlens Survey and Questionnaire 2022 n/a In 2022, the Department of Climate Change, Energy, the Environment and Water of Australia deployed Converlens as its Survey and Questionnaire application to manage the public consultation for the National Electric Vehicle Strategy. The Converlens implementation served as the consultation and submissions platform for a federal policy engagement in Australia, collecting approximately 1,700 submissions and capturing over one million words of respondent content to inform policy development. The deployment emphasized submission intake and respondent management capabilities, supporting both open text submissions and structured questionnaire inputs. Converlens was used to process and organize large volumes of textual feedback, enabling thematic review workflows, content tagging and exportable reporting consistent with Survey and Questionnaire functional workflows. The implementation included dashboarding and content analysis features to surface themes and accelerate analyst review. Operationally the platform centralized public feedback for the National Electric Vehicle Strategy, and was used by policy analysts and engagement teams within the department across Australia. Converlens directly supported departmental analysis and reporting functions for federal climate and energy policy outcomes, feeding synthesized content into policy drafting and stakeholder engagement processes. Governance focused on embedding Converlens outputs into departmental analyst workflows and reporting cadences to support decision making on climate and energy policy. The implementation prioritized structured intake, text analytics and reporting to accelerate synthesis of stakeholder submissions for the National Electric Vehicle Strategy.
Department of Education, Australian Government Government 1677 $1.3B Australia Converlens Converlens Survey and Questionnaire 2025 n/a In 2025 the Department of Education, Australian Government deployed Converlens to power its public consultation hub for projects such as the 2025 National Research Infrastructure Roadmap issues paper, using Converlens as the core Survey and Questionnaire platform to collect stakeholder submissions and structured survey responses. The deployment served a research-policy engagement use case in Australia, providing a publicly accessible consultation portal that centralized submission intake for the NRI roadmap and related education research policy consultations. This implementation positioned Converlens as the primary tool for stakeholder engagement and evidence gathering within the consultation program. Converlens was configured to deliver standard Survey and Questionnaire capabilities, including public-facing consultation pages, multi-question survey forms with conditional logic, file and written submission capture, and administrative response management for review and publishing. The configuration emphasized structured response capture and reporting readiness, enabling exportable data sets and compliance with public consultation workflows common to government research and policy teams. Converlens provided role-based access to manage submissions, moderate content, and publish consultation outcomes while preserving the integrity of stakeholder inputs. Operational coverage focused on the Department of Education’s policy and research functions and the specific NRI roadmap consultation stream, with Converlens supporting stakeholder engagement workflows across the consultation lifecycle from intake through review. Governance features were applied to control publication, manage submission visibility, and align retention of consultation records with public sector requirements. The implementation directly supported the department’s objective to gather stakeholder input that will inform the NRI roadmap and related education research policy decisions.
Treasury Australia Government 1291 $3.7B Australia Converlens Converlens Survey and Questionnaire 2022 n/a In 2022, Treasury Australia deployed Converlens to run public consultations, using the Converlens Survey and Questionnaire application to manage formal stakeholder engagement. The initial rollout targeted high‑visibility consultation hubs, including the Employment White Paper consultation, providing a centralized public portal for submission intake and response publication. Converlens was configured to capture structured submissions and free text inputs through public-facing consultation forms, support moderation and publishing workflows, and maintain a consultative record for policy teams. The implementation emphasized configurable questionnaire logic, submission tracking, and public response publication as core functional capabilities aligned with Survey and Questionnaire workflows. Operationally the deployment served Treasury policy teams across Australia, operating as a government public consultation and stakeholder engagement platform that consolidated inputs from citizens, industry and stakeholders. Governance and workflow changes included standardized consultation intake processes and publication procedures to ensure submissions could be surfaced to analysts and authors. The rollout produced published submissions and generated inputs that were incorporated into Treasury policy reports and reviews, informing policy development and official outputs as documented in the Employment White Paper and other consultation reports.
